Publisher's Synopsis

"There was a flash of black-striped, brown-gold body. Black claws, then yellow fangs gleaming..."



Amber reluctantly spends the summer with her uncle and twin cousins at their New Zealand Wildlife Park. Her parents have gone to Europe without her and she's afraid they might split up. She is also afraid of Tiger, the one animal who appears to be always watching, always waiting - the most likely to escape his comfortable environment.



But family concerns and Tiger are not the only problems for Amber this summer. Strange things are happening. Is someone trying to sabotage the park? No one knows who to trust. And then Amber's worst fears are realised... Tiger escapes.
